Event overview

This April, The Mission Continues invites you to celebrate Earth Month by joining the Earth Month: Rooted in Service campaign! It's a time to take action, honor our planet, and uplift communities through veteran-led service projects. We are going back to Furtick Farms, to assist with spring up, planting 30 trees and building ADA planters.

Furtick Farms offers events and classes for adults and children to learn to use their "green thumb". It's run by Green City Teachers, an organization of Philadelphia school teachers that wants to teach the youth to obtain sustainable food resources. We are proud to get our hands dirty, clean up, build some planters and continue our relationship with Furtick Farms.

Who We Are

The Mission Continues is a national non-profit that empowers veterans to continue serving in our nation’s under-resourced communities, giving veterans the opportunity to keep serving even after the uniform comes off, right here at home. Our programs deploy veterans and volunteers to work alongside nonprofit partners and community leaders to improve educational resources, tackle food insecurity, foster neighborhood identity, and more.

What is a Service Platoon? 

Service Platoons are your opportunity to engage and connect with veterans and community members while generating community impact in a real and tangible way. Led by veteran volunteer platoon leaders, each platoon works with dedicated community partners and volunteers to provide the manpower and support that they need to help them do their work more effectively. 

We currently have service platoons in more than 40+ cities across the country that are having events at least once a month. Everyone is invited to serve, regardless of veteran status: a service platoon is for you if you have a passion for service.
